71815 ACDGB/P4 Bearing Product Overview & Core Advantages
The 71815 ACDGB/P4 is a single-row angular contact ball bearing designed for high-precision applications requiring exceptional rotational accuracy and rigidity. Manufactured to P4 tolerance class, this bearing delivers superior dimensional stability and running accuracy. Its 25° contact angle provides optimal performance for combined loads, effectively handling both radial and axial forces in one direction. The phenolic cage and universal matching capability make it ideal for precision spindle arrangements where high-speed operation and thermal stability are critical requirements.
71815 ACDGB/P4 Bearing Model Code Explained, Specifications & Naming Convention
| Code Segment | Technical Meaning |
|---|---|
| 71815 | Basic bearing designation with 75mm bore diameter |
| AC | Angular Contact design with 25° contact angle |
| DGB | Universal Matchable bearing for preloaded arrangements |
| P4 | High-precision tolerance class for superior running accuracy |
71815 ACDGB/P4 Bearing Structural Features & Performance Benefits
High Precision Construction: Manufactured to P4 tolerance class with tight dimensional control (±0.004mm on bore and OD), ensuring minimal runout and vibration for precision applications.
Optimized Load Capacity: The 25° contact angle provides excellent performance for combined radial and axial loads, with dynamic load rating of 2992 lbf and static load rating of 3600 lbf.
High-Speed Capability: The phenolic cage offers superior strength-to-weight ratio and thermal stability, enabling operation at limiting speeds up to 28,000 rpm while maintaining dimensional stability.
Universal Matching Design: As a Universal Matchable (SU) bearing, it can be paired with other identical bearings to create preloaded sets of 2, 3, or 4 bearings, providing flexibility in spindle design and assembly.
Thermal Performance: The phenolic cage material and chrome steel construction maintain dimensional stability across the operating temperature range of -30°C to 110°C.
